Fuse Location

Does anyone know the location of the fuse that controls the small indicator lights on the cord reel, water line reel, water auto fill switches.

2008 Monaco Dynasty Ren IV

The cord and hose reel are not on fuses there is a ltle black breaker right above the switches for those devices. If they blow you just reset. Shows white when breaker is blown.

Thanks everyone but it is none of the above on mine. Look to the left when you open the panel that exposes the hose reel. On the left side there is a 10 amp in line fuse. I could find no mention of it anywhere in the manual. I would not give up and went back and found it. I cant belive it is not mentioned anywhere in the manual.
